Georgiana is a Catalan, English, Greek, and Romanian name. It is a variation of the female names Georgina and Georgia. It comes from the Greek word Γεώργιος, meaning "farmer". A variant spelling is Georgianna.

The Story of Georgianna
Georgianna first appeared in U.S. Social Security Administration records as a baby girl name in 1880, with 18 babies given the name that year. Its peak popularity came in 1942, when 180 Georgiannas were born — ranking #554 that year. As of 2026, Georgianna ranks #4,273 for baby girls with 33 births, gradually rising (+6%). In total, more than 9K Georgiannas have been born in the U.S. since records began in 1880, spanning the 1880s through the 2020s.
